Amarillo welcomed a new voice to its City Council during a special meeting on June 24, 2025, as David Prescott was officially sworn in as the council member for Place 3. The ceremony marked a significant moment for both Prescott and the community, emphasizing the importance of civic duty and commitment to public service.
Prescott took the oath of office, pledging to faithfully execute his responsibilities and uphold the Constitution and laws of the United States and Texas. This formal induction was celebrated by friends and family, highlighting the community's support for their new representative.
